Job Summary
The Special Educator is responsible for planning, delivering and monitoring individualized educational and vocational training programs for children, adolescents or adults with special needs (intellectual disability, autism, learning disability, multiple disabilities, etc.) to help them achieve maximum independence, learning and employability.
Key Responsibilities
1. Assessment & Planning
Assess each beneficiary’s abilities, challenges, learning level and support needs.
Prepare Individualized Education Plans (IEPs) or training plans with measurable goals.
Review and update plans periodically based on progress.
2. Teaching & Training
Conduct structured and functional teaching sessions (academic, life skills, social skills, vocational skills).
Use special education strategies like:
Activity-based learning
Visual supports
Task analysis
Behavioural reinforcement
Adapt teaching methods based on different disabilities and learning styles.
3. Behaviour & Emotional Support
Support students with behavioural challenges using positive behaviour support strategies.
Promote emotional regulation, social interaction and communication skills.
4. Collaboration
Work closely with:
Caregivers
Therapists (speech, occupational, etc.)
Psychologists
Vocational trainers
Participate in case reviews, parent meetings and multidisciplinary discussions.
5. Parent / Caregiver Guidance
Counsel parents and caregivers on:
Home-based training strategies
Behaviour management
Developmental expectations
Provide regular feedback on student progress.
6. Documentation & Reporting
Maintain accurate records:
Assessments
IEPs
Attendance
Progress reports
Prepare reports for internal review, donors or government authorities when required.
7. Inclusion & Advocacy
Promote inclusive practices within the NGO and external environments (schools, employers, community).
Sensitize peers, staff and stakeholders about disability awareness.
8. Compliance & Ethics
Follow ethical practices, child protection policies, POSH, and disability rights laws (RPwD Act, 2016).
Maintain confidentiality and dignity of all beneficiaries.
Qualifications
Bachelor’s or Master’s Degree in:
Special Education (B.Ed / M.Ed Special Education)
Rehabilitation Science
RCI (Rehabilitation Council of India) registration preferred / mandatory as per norms.
Skills & Competencies
Strong understanding of different disabilities and intervention methods
Patience, empathy and emotional intelligence
Good communication skills (with children, families and professionals)
Ability to design adaptive learning materials
Documentation and reporting skills
